29 Salisbury Street, Hessle, HU13 0SE is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 990 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£201,938 , which equates to approximately £204 per square foot. It was last sold on 22 Jul 2010 for £129,000. Since then, the value has increased by £72,938, representing a 56.5% increase, or approximately 3.7% per year.

The current estimated value of £201,938 is:

  • 10.1% higher than the average property price on Salisbury Street
  • 12.7% higher than the average in the HU13 0SE postcode area
  • and 16.6% lower than the average price for Hessle as a whole

29 Salisbury Street, Hessle, East Riding Of Yorkshire, Humberside, HU13 0SE has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 15 Sep 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Mar 2010,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 14.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 250mm loft insulation to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from mostly double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 7%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
